Dope Thief’s Brian Tyree Henry joins upcoming Apple Original Films feature

Apple TV confirmed today that Brian Tyree Henry, who recently starred alongside Wagner Moura ( , ) on , is joining a new feature film from Apple Original Films. Here are the details.

Last November, that film director and screenwriter Gavin O’Connor was developing “Running,” a movie that “follows a homeless high school running prodigy on the hunt for greatness as he uses his gifts to outrun his past and find a family.”

Today, Apple confirmed that Brian Tyree Henry has joined the cast and will star opposite Spike Fearn ( , ).

This marks the third collaboration between Henry and Apple. He previously starred opposite Jennifer Lawrence in , which earned him an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or. He also starred in , a performance that landed him an Emmy nomination for Outstanding Lead Actor in a Limited or Anthology Series or Movie.

Running is being written by Bill Dubuque, who collaborated with O’Connor on . Following its premiere, the movie quickly became Amazon MGM Studios’ second most-watched film of all time on streaming, according to Deadline .

As is usually the case with features in early production stages, there are no details on when the movie is expected to land on Apple TV.
